Output 838337a14588ebd9f72b1f3fc64c53aab183f41850e2303d3fb7984b2ad92015: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 000c2fb76bc685fe4e7333618cf48db9fdc9b7c8 OP_EQUAL
address
D59M8z1t1N4vAmFELFsLFvYH6LzHUorc1E
transaction
838337a14588ebd9f72b1f3fc64c53aab183f41850e2303d3fb7984b2ad92015
spent
true